Transaction e99c1ec6c89a4a46f63e59b6de105143d0c7ff22ace55977d762f7d3bb466171
1 Input
1 Output
-
e99c1ec6c89a4a46f63e59b6de105143d0c7ff22ace55977d762f7d3bb466171:0
- value
- 3599961600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e1dd7e86d6196c188b97294a4e30753e925cb99 OP_EQUAL
- address
- 37MTZzWX7ii7C39mHgWWJkwy97HSLTVW5s